Python入门:猜数游戏与函数、面向对象解析
需积分: 10 3 浏览量
更新于2024-09-06
收藏 84KB DOCX 举报
"该资源为Python基础快速入门教程,涵盖了Python的基本语法,包括猜数小游戏的实现、函数的定义和使用以及简单的面向对象编程概念。教程旨在帮助初学者快速掌握Python编程,通过阅读文档和实践代码,可以提升编程技能。作者承诺在博客中更新相关内容,读者可以在博客中找到更多细节和互动讨论。"
在Python编程中,基础是非常重要的,这个快速入门教程主要讲解了几个关键的概念:
1. **Python猜数小游戏**:这是一个很好的练习,用于熟悉条件判断和用户输入处理。通过导入`random`库,我们可以生成一个1到100之间的随机数作为答案。然后,利用`input()`函数获取用户输入的猜测,通过`while`循环不断进行判断和提示,直到用户猜中为止。这个游戏展示了基本的逻辑控制结构和输入输出操作。
2. **Python函数**:函数是编程中复用代码的基础。它们可以接受参数,执行特定任务,并可能返回结果。例如,`Max_num(a, b)`函数用于比较两个数并返回较大的数。函数定义的关键字是`def`,后面跟着函数名和参数列表。函数体内部的代码需要缩进,`return`语句用于返回函数的结果。在提供的例子中,我们定义了一个比较两个数的函数,并在主程序中调用它。
3. **面向对象编程**:面向对象编程是Python的一大特色。在这个例子中,我们模拟了两个新同学自我介绍的场景。虽然没有深入到类和对象的概念,但是提到了使用字符串格式化来构造输出,如`print("My name is %s and come from %s" % (name, city))`,这在简单的对象表示中很常见。面向对象编程允许我们将数据(属性)和操作(方法)封装在一起,形成类,从而更好地组织代码。
这个快速入门教程是学习Python的良好起点,它涵盖了基本的语法元素和编程思想。通过实践这些示例,你可以逐步理解Python的核心概念,并为进一步深入学习打下坚实基础。记得经常查看作者的博客,获取最新的更新和互动支持。
144 浏览量
2023-07-30 上传
2023-07-30 上传
2023-06-12 上传
2023-07-30 上传
2022-07-08 上传
测试狂人
- 粉丝: 2w+
- 资源: 5
最新资源
- Ps基本功能PPT,附带简单的技巧讲解
- 电脑硬件故障引起系统问题
- 关于LCD的一些知识
- 自动测试 IBM Rational 技术白皮书
- cmake 学习教程
- protues学习教程
- XP下的JDK安装.DOC
- Fedora-10-Installation-Configration-FAQ-Update-1
- Fedora-10-Installaion_Configuration-FAQ
- linux驱动程序设计入门简洁教程
- C与C++中的异常处理
- SCJP 1.6 TestInside真题(中文,台湾人译的)
- 基于单片机控制的自动往返小汽车新设计.pdf
- 中兴公司CDMA原理
- EJB 3 In Action - Manning
- 水晶报表用户指南 9.0